What makes it work

What makes a strong Substitute Teachers, Short-Term CV

Targeted headline

A specific role-aligned headline beats generic phrases like "results-driven professional".

Quantified achievements

Numbers, percentages, and concrete outcomes make every bullet stronger and more believable.

ATS-readable layout

Clean structure, real fonts, and properly tagged sections so applicant tracking systems can parse every word.
